William Henderson

Best pupusas in Phoenix! Pupusas as are my very favorite central American dish, I make the very well myself, I was taught some tricks by some kind Salvadoreños, but even my pupusas aren’t as good as these! I’ve had some the size of dinner plates and some as small as silver dollar hotcakes, these ones are about the size of a hotcake, and pretty thick, but not doughy in any way! It’s almost like they are slightly leavened they are so fluffy and delicious I could eat 30 in one sighting ?. So savory and well seasoned and not the least bit oily or greasy! I had a cheese one which was immaculate, and the chicharron and cheese was excellent as well. I only wish they had a chicken one as well. The tamales are good and the platano plate as well. These ladies know what they are doing! The only thing I wasn’t used to was their salsa is more watery and non-tomato based like I’m used to with salsa roja, but the curtido was on point, and the empanada de platano was a nice treat after dinner. Highly recommended!
